Pros

Great product, great people and a flexibility in work/work style. Lots of room for creativity and personal expression.

Cons

Little to no training...ever. No centralized help; need to rely on colleagues for answers to basic questions. Heavy on executives and executive promotions with little justification...seems like a good ol' boy's club or fraternity. Executives are out of sight except for the CEO's weekly message, which at least makes the effort. Town hall events are a joke and are self-gratifying. Terrible time keeping system and beyond dismal expense reporting system...shocking at a technology company.

Pros

Flexibility and love supporting customers. Ability to travel to new places and encounter new cultures. Wonderfully generous colleagues and wealth of knowledge contained within the company's employees.

Cons

Management from top down is reminiscent of a college fraternity. Plans are discarded as middle-management rotates in and out. About 8 managers in the course of 2 years with the company. Annual reviews and merit compensation are a complete joke. Meaningful communication from upper management is incredibly weak. It looks like a good ol' boy's club to most of the company's hard working front line. I am embarrassed to tell my friends to apply for a job here.
